Austrian breaded veal or pork cutlet, fried until crisp. It is a staple across Lower Austria and a classic dish in local inns.
Roast pork with crackling, usually served with dumplings and cabbage. A hearty traditional Sunday meal in regional taverns.
Slow-cooked beef in a rich onion sauce, often seasoned with paprika. A warming classic found in many traditional Austrian restaurants.

Moderate for Austria. Hotels and dining are usually cheaper than Vienna, while local transit and daily essentials stay fairly manageable for visitors.
Service is often included, but rounding up is standard. In restaurants add about 5-10%; round up in cafes and taxis for good service.
